Gandara Amarasinghe is a scholar working on Polymers and Plastics, Biomaterials and Fluid Flow and Transfer Processes. According to data from OpenAlex, Gandara Amarasinghe has authored 13 papers receiving a total of 422 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Polymers and Plastics, 6 papers in Biomaterials and 4 papers in Fluid Flow and Transfer Processes. Recurrent topics in Gandara Amarasinghe's work include Polymer crystallization and properties (10 papers), Polymer Nanocomposites and Properties (9 papers) and biodegradable polymer synthesis and properties (6 papers). Gandara Amarasinghe is often cited by papers focused on Polymer crystallization and properties (10 papers), Polymer Nanocomposites and Properties (9 papers) and biodegradable polymer synthesis and properties (6 papers). Gandara Amarasinghe collaborates with scholars based in Australia. Gandara Amarasinghe's co-authors include Robert A. Shanks, L.M.W.K. Gunaratne, Antonietta Genovese, David E. Mainwaring, Z. Mathys, C. Preston, Fei Chen, Fei Chen and Fuyao Chen and has published in prestigious journals such as Polymer, Journal of Applied Polymer Science and Polymer Degradation and Stability.
